**PRINCIPAL RESPONSIBILITIES**:

- **Service Delivery**

To be responsible for the effective delivery of high quality housing support and resettlement services for homeless people
- **Resource Management**

To be responsible for the effective utilisation of a range of accommodation options, with a focus on resettling people from supported accommodation into permanent accommodation.
- **Casework Management**

To work with clients ensuring provision of advice, support, motivation, crisis intervention and future planning, is appropriate to the expressed needs of service users
- **Organisational Responsibilities**

To be responsible for contributing to the running of Willow Housing integrated services for homeless people.

**SPECIFIC DUTIES**:
Support Workers will be required to carry out risk assessments and create support plans for each tenant in their case load. Support Workers will carry out weekly supervision sessions with the tenants to ensure they are able to manage their tenancy effectively. The support sessions involve a number of services including:

- Financial Budgeting
- Assistance with GP registration
- Signposting for drugs and alcohol support
- Accommodation search (Long Term Accommodation)
- Access to education provision
- Overcoming employability issues
- Avoiding rent arrears.
- Reducing anti-social behaviour
